One crucial aspect of nanotechnology research is access control. The nature of nanoscale materials and devices requires strict control over who can access them and how they are handled to ensure safety and prevent unauthorized use. Assistantship programs often include training in access control protocols and best practices to ensure that research is conducted in a secure and responsible manner. Through assistantship programs in nanotechnology, participants have the opportunity to work alongside leading experts in the field, engage in groundbreaking research projects, and gain practical skills that will help them succeed in their careers. These programs may involve assisting with experiments, analyzing data, conducting literature reviews, and collaborating on research papers and presentations. Furthermore, assistantship programs can provide valuable networking opportunities, allowing participants to connect with industry professionals, potential employers, and other researchers in the field. Building relationships within the nanotechnology community can open doors to future collaborations, job opportunities, and career advancement.
